Here are some of my beliefs about the healing work:

  • I believe we can do hard things, have painful experiences and still experience joy and pleasure.

  • I deeply respect people who ask for help. This is the first step to change and maybe the hardest.

  • I believe we have all the tools we need. It's about remembering they are within us and that it's ok to need help finding and using them.

  • Most of us were not taught how to communicate effectively, make healthy boundaries or know what a secure relationship looks and feels like. This is common and can be repaired.

​

The work I do:

  • I provide opportunities to challenge old patterns and beliefs that no longer serve you and find new ways to thrive.

  • We will meet and talk about where you feel out of sync, what you want to change and what has been getting in the way of creating the life you want.

  • Together we can co-create concrete tools and coping skills that allow you to make new connections with yourself and others.

  • I have experienced the healing power of art personally and professionally. Art can help us translate our inner messages and guides into the external world. It is our link to ourselves and the great mysteries of life.

  • I offer guided and unstructured opportunities to self-express and process using art materials. *You do not need to have any art experience or background to do art therapy.

Working With Me

I have a range of experience in mental health and wellness including work in a senior living

community, children’s hospital, alternative school and community mental health. I love

weaving together all of these experiences to create a framework for my current work while

holding an awareness of all stages of life and ability.

​

My Education

  • Master’s degree in Counseling and Art Therapy from Marylhurst University, 2011

  • Bachelor’s degree in Studio Art and Women’s Studies from St. Olaf College, 2006

​

Currently I offer individual and group therapy for adults 18 years and up specializing in

women’s issues. If you are looking for a safe and supportive therapeutic environment for

authentic, compassionate and creative healing we may be a good fit.
